1. Introduction
The water - soluble silymarin extract from Silybum marianum, commonly known as milk thistle, has emerged as a valuable ingredient in the food industry. Silymarin is a complex of flavonolignans, and its water - soluble form offers unique properties that make it suitable for various applications. This extract has attracted significant attention due to its potential health benefits and functional properties in food products.
2. Natural Antioxidant Properties
2.1. Protection against Oxidative Rancidity
One of the primary applications of water - soluble silymarin extract in the food industry is as a natural antioxidant. Oxidative rancidity is a major concern in the food industry, especially for lipid - containing products. Silymarin can scavenge free radicals and prevent the oxidation of lipids. For example, in oils and margarines, which are rich in unsaturated fats, the addition of water - soluble silymarin extract can significantly inhibit lipid peroxidation. This helps in maintaining the quality and freshness of the products for a longer period.
2.2. Extension of Shelf - life
By acting as an antioxidant, the water - soluble silymarin extract contributes to the extension of the shelf - life of food products. It reduces the rate of oxidative reactions that lead to spoilage, such as the development of off - flavors, discoloration, and the degradation of nutritional components. In bakery products, for instance, it can prevent the rancidity of fats used in the dough, thereby increasing the product's shelf - life. This is particularly important in the commercial food sector where products need to have a reasonable shelf - life for distribution and storage.
3. Applications in Functional Food Development
3.1. Hepatoprotective Properties
Water - soluble silymarin extract has well - known hepatoprotective properties. In the context of functional food development, this makes it an ideal ingredient for health - promoting foods. The liver plays a crucial role in the body's metabolism, and protecting it from damage is essential for overall health. Silymarin can help in preventing liver damage caused by toxins, such as alcohol and certain medications. Foods fortified with water - soluble silymarin extract can be targeted towards consumers who are concerned about liver health, such as those with a history of liver disease or those who consume alcohol regularly.
3.2. Potential for Nutraceutical - Rich Foods
The extract can also be used to develop nutraceutical - rich foods. Nutraceuticals are products that provide both nutritional and medicinal benefits. With its antioxidant and hepatoprotective properties, water - soluble silymarin extract can be combined with other beneficial ingredients to create foods that offer multiple health benefits. For example, it can be added to energy bars or smoothies along with vitamins, minerals, and other plant - based extracts to enhance their overall health - promoting properties.
4. Contribution to Flavor and Color Stability
4.1. Flavor Stability
Water - soluble silymarin extract plays a role in maintaining the flavor stability of food products. Oxidative processes can lead to the development of off - flavors, which can significantly affect the acceptability of food. By preventing oxidation, the extract helps in preserving the natural flavors of the food. In meat products, for example, it can prevent the formation of rancid flavors that are often associated with lipid oxidation. This ensures that the product retains its original taste and aroma, enhancing its consumer appeal.
4.2. Color Stability
Similarly, the extract is beneficial for color stability. Discoloration in food products can occur due to various factors, including oxidation. In fruits and vegetables, which are often used in processed foods, water - soluble silymarin extract can help in maintaining their natural color. For instance, it can prevent the browning of apples or the fading of the color in berries during processing and storage. This not only improves the visual appeal of the food but also indicates its freshness and quality.
5. Incorporation into Different Food Categories
5.1. Dairy Products
Dairy products are a major part of the food industry. Water - soluble silymarin extract can be incorporated into dairy products such as milk, yogurt, and cheese. In milk, it can act as an antioxidant, protecting the milk fat from oxidation. In yogurt, it can contribute to the overall health - promoting properties, especially considering its potential hepatoprotective effects. For cheese, it can help in maintaining the flavor and color stability during the aging process.
5.2. Beverages
Beverages offer a wide range of opportunities for the use of water - soluble silymarin extract. In fruit juices, it can enhance the antioxidant content and help in maintaining the color and flavor stability. In functional beverages like energy drinks or herbal teas, it can be added for its hepatoprotective and antioxidant properties. For example, in a green tea - based beverage, the addition of silymarin extract can provide an extra layer of antioxidant protection and potential health benefits.
5.3. Confectionery
In the confectionery industry, water - soluble silymarin extract can be used in chocolates, candies, and other sweet products. In chocolates, it can prevent the rancidity of cocoa butter, which is a major component. It can also contribute to the flavor stability of candies, especially those with added fats or oils. Additionally, in confectionery products that are marketed as "healthier" options, such as dark chocolates with added antioxidants, the silymarin extract can be a valuable ingredient.
6. Safety and Regulatory Considerations
Before the widespread use of water - soluble silymarin extract in the food industry, safety and regulatory aspects need to be carefully considered.
6.1. Safety Evaluation
Studies have been conducted to evaluate the safety of silymarin extract. Generally, it has been found to be safe for consumption at appropriate levels. However, like any food ingredient, it is important to determine the maximum safe dosage. Excessive intake may lead to potential adverse effects, although such cases are rare. For example, some studies have investigated the long - term effects of high - dose silymarin consumption on liver function and overall health.
6.2. Regulatory Requirements
Regulatory bodies around the world have different requirements for the use of food additives, including natural extracts like silymarin. In the European Union, for example, food additives need to meet certain purity and safety standards. In the United States,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) regulates the use of food ingredients. Manufacturers need to ensure that the water - soluble silymarin extract they use complies with the relevant regulations in the regions where their products are sold.

FAQ:
1. How does silymarin extract from milk thistle act as an antioxidant in the food industry?
Water - soluble silymarin extract can act as an antioxidant by preventing the oxidation of fats and oils in food. It donates electrons to free radicals, which are highly reactive molecules that can cause oxidative rancidity. In lipid - rich products such as oils and margarines, it inhibits lipid peroxidation, thereby protecting the food from spoilage and extending its shelf - life.
2. What are the benefits of using silymarin extract in functional food development?
The silymarin extract has hepatoprotective properties. When added to functional foods, it can offer health benefits related to liver protection. This makes it a valuable ingredient for developing foods that are not only nutritious but also have specific health - promoting functions.
3. How does silymarin extract contribute to the flavor and color stability of food products?
Although the exact mechanisms are not fully understood, silymarin extract may interact with certain compounds in food that are responsible for flavor and color changes. By inhibiting oxidative reactions that can lead to off - flavors and color fading, it helps to maintain the desirable characteristics of food products over time.
4. Can silymarin extract be used in all types of food?
While silymarin extract has potential applications in many types of food, it may not be suitable for all. For example, its use may need to be carefully considered in products where it could interact with other ingredients or where its flavor might be incompatible. However, in lipid - rich foods, health - promoting foods, and those where antioxidant properties are desired, it has shown great potential.
5. How is the safety of silymarin extract in food ensured?
To ensure the safety of silymarin extract in food, extensive research and testing are carried out. Regulatory bodies set limits on its use and establish safety standards. Manufacturers also need to follow good manufacturing practices to ensure the purity and quality of the extract used in food products.
6. Are there any potential drawbacks to using silymarin extract in the food industry?
One potential drawback could be cost. The extraction and purification processes of silymarin may be relatively expensive, which could limit its widespread use. Additionally, as mentioned before, there may be compatibility issues with certain food ingredients or flavors, which need to be carefully managed.
